Usually we fly out of Omaha Eppley Airport but found unbeatable prices on flights out of Kansas City for our upcoming cruise so we opted to fly out of K.C.

Since we will obviously be driving to K.C. and leaving our car in one of the "Long Term" parking lots, my question is "How safe/secure are the long term parking lots? In other words, should I be concerned about our car being broken into ?

(Hopefully this doesn't jinx me...): I travel for a big chunk of my time and KC is my home airport, so I routinely park my car for a week at a time, at least 20 times per year. Nothing has ever happened. It's not like it's in the middle of the city...it's out in the middle of farms.

 

You'll have a bunch of options: Long-Term Parking operated by the airport, and Long-Term Parking operated by individual companies (Parking Spot, Park Air Express). I usually do Parking Spot and it's great. I've heard good things about Park Air Express too, but have never done it. The cheapest will be the airport Long-Term itself - there are three lots (one for each terminal), and 20-30 stops per lot, so you won't have to walk far at all. The bus comes by, picks you up, takes you to the terminal you are park for (Lot B = Terminal B, etc.). Coming back, just wait for the blue bus and it goes to the corresponding lot (you'll have to change buses if you depart and return to different terminals - just let the driver know when you board).

A little "out of the box" thinking...but you also might want to see if any of the hotels adjacent to MCI offer a "fly and park" package where your car gets to sit in their parking space for free during the cruise if you stay at their hotel one night...

Many of them do. The closest hotel to the airport is the Marriott. I've done a stay and park there and it was something like $125 for a night (nice hotel) + one week of parking, and there was a quick shuttle to/from the terminals. But there are other airport hotels that offer it too.
